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y vowed on Saturday that Ukraine will not cede any of its territories to Russia as part of a potential peace deal with Moscow.

Zelenskyy made the remarks ahead of a meeting between President Donald Trump and Russian President Vladimir Putin in Alaska next week to discuss a possible cease-fire in the ongoing Russia-Ukraine war.
